Is inflatino production during preheating a threat to nucleosynthesis?

Abstract

We discuss the production of inflatino the superpartner of the inflaton due to vacuum fluctuations during preheating and argue that they do decay alongwith the inflaton to produce a thermal bath. Therefore they do not survive until nucleosynthsis to pose a threat to it.
